Migration step 7: The translation-string extraction script for Lumenwe has moved from the legacy Tarnfield runner to the new pipeline. Support staff triaging missing-string reports should first confirm the nightly extraction completed, then check that the locale list matches production. Please review the step output carefully before escalating. The extraction service currently uses the configuration shown below.

deployment values, taweg-bajop:
[fenvan]
port = 5672
team = holmir
host = fenvan.orvexio.example
region = lower-1
access_code = ac_b98bc6
timeout_ms = 1500

## Approvals — Bulk Edits in the Marrowfield Admin Table

Bulk edits affecting more than 50 rows require prior approval. Submit the proposed change set through the staging preview, confirm the row count, and attach the dry-run output. Contractors may not self-approve. Edits touching billing fields always need a second reviewer. The person with final authority over bulk-edit approvals is named below.

account owner for bawip-tahag: Raleth Quenok

## Step 4: Migrate the reminder job

Medloop's clinic appointment reminder job now runs under the Quartzel scheduler. Plugin authors must drop the legacy `onRemind` hook and register a `reminderDispatch` handler instead. Retry semantics are unchanged. Verify your plugin against the staging scheduler before release. Apply the following settings to your plugin manifest.

config for kagup-hahig:
druwyn:
  pin: 2801
  metrics_host: metrics.druwyn.zemvarlabs.internal
  tenant: sorius
  seal: seal_798a43d7